| This historic boutique hotel is situated in downtown Halifax, one km (one-half mile) from the Maritime Museum of the Atlantic. Free local calls and cable/satellite TV comes in all standard rooms, which have one queen bed with a goose down duvet. Complimentary Continental breakfast is provided for guests each morning.

| Lots of stairs. These are old houses converted to hotel and rooms vary (some very small) - know what you are getting before hand. You may end up in 3rd floor walk up (no elevator) They have central air with no individual room controls - they will give you electric fan and portable heater instead. Too much inconvenience for the price. They have tiny room TV -13 inch.

| Great, SAFE, location. We had a rental car (free parking), but never used it. Walking distance to all attractions and restaurants. Free use of umbrellas, it rained during our trip. The staff was wonderful, polite and attentive. Our room was lovely, private balcony, clean, nicely decorated, queen bed, 2 wingbacks, sofa, etc.. Dined at "Stories", prix fixed dinner...innovative,fresh, great service. Breakfast was delicious...Great Coffee! I applaud the staff for making our stay a WONDERFUL experience.
